Property Insights of 2-amino-4-(1H-indol-5-yl)buta-1,3-diene-1,1,3-tricarbonitrile

The XLogP value of 1.7 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 2-amino-4-(1H-indol-5-yl)buta-1,3-diene-1,1,3-tricarbonitrile. The TPSA of 113.0 Ų falls within the moderate polarity range, balancing permeability and solubility for 2-amino-4-(1H-indol-5-yl)buta-1,3-diene-1,1,3-tricarbonitrile. Following Lipinski's Rule of Five, 2-amino-4-(1H-indol-5-yl)buta-1,3-diene-1,1,3-tricarbonitrile has 2 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
